Getting the diagnosis right changes everything
Most people living with musculoskeletal pain have been told the same thing: rest, take painkillers, and wait. For many, that’s not enough — because the root cause has never been properly identified.
The same symptom can come from very different sources. Pain on the outer hip might be GTPS, hip arthritis, or a referred pain from the lower back — and each requires a completely different treatment approach. Knee pain that feels like arthritis might be a tendon problem. Arm tingling that seems like carpal tunnel might actually be a trapped nerve in the neck.
